中国航空结构用新型钛合金研究  被引量:39

Studies of New-Type Titanium Alloys for Aviation Industry Application in China

摘  要:中国钛产业近几年来得到了快速发展,钛材产量已经位居世界第4位,但航空结构用钛合金产品(锻件和大棒材等半成品)只占10%左右,距离世界水平的50%差距甚远。所以,加强航空结构用新型钛合金材料技术及其应用研究,提高航空结构用钛合金的加工技术和应用水平,建立具有中国特色的航空结构用钛合金材料体系,是提高钛合金在航空工业用量的重要推动力和保障。本文从分析国内外钛合金产业结构特点出发,重点阐述航空结构用新型钛合金材料和新型热工艺技术的最新研究进展。In the recent years, the titanium industry in China has been developed rapidly and the output of titanium products has been always located at the fourth place of the world. Yet, however, the amount of titanium alloys applied in aeronautical structures has just been 10 percent of the total titanium amount, which is far behind the international level. To strengthen the studies of technologies and applications of new-type titanium alloys in aeronautical structures, to lift their manufacture techniques and application levels and to establish the titanium alloys system in applications of aeronautical structures, is an impetus and important guarantee to increase the amount of titanium alloys in aviation industry application. This paper begins with analysis of the industrial features of titanium alloys at home and abroad and focuses on the recent developments of new-type titanium alloy materials and new manufacture techniques of titanium alloys.
